Take Flight
The stranded colourwork in this sweater is based on an old Icelandic spell for bewitching a horse to fly. The original spell was a bit gruesome, but a reworking of the spell sigil makes for a mesmerizing yoke design. Perhaps you'll feel a bit of air under your feet while wearing this sweater.
Size: 36/38/40/42/44/46/48/50/52/54" around chest (with 3-4" of positive ease, so if your bust measures 32", make size 36).
Materials: Diamond Luxury Highlander (100% Peruvian Wool, sport weight, 50g/138m per ball); 6/7/7/8/9/10/11/12/13 balls in Marine Blue (col. 3308) and 1/1/2/2/2/2/2/3/3 ball(s) in Avocado (col. 3304).
Gauge: 24 sts x 32 rows in stockinette.
Other Materials: Waste yarn and 3 mm crochet hook for provisional cast on.
Needle Size: 3.25 mm 24" circular needles and a set of 4 or 5 double-pointed needles in the same size (or size required to obtain gauge).
